Pros & Cons

Auto-generated from official data — head-to-head differences and gaps vs the national average.

South Bend, IN
Pros
Homes cost $663k less ($113,800 vs $777,100)
Rent averages $1042/mo less ($935 vs $1,977)
24% cheaper overall cost of living than Westminster
Stronger job market — unemployment is 2.0 pts lower (5.5%)
Commutes run 8 min shorter each way
Living costs sit below the national average (index 91.4)
Cons
Median income trails Westminster by $31,215/yr
Violent crime (965.0/100k) is above the U.S. average of 380
Snowy winters — about 65" of snow per year
Westminster, CA
Pros
Households earn $31,215 more per year on average
55% less violent crime than South Bend
Milder winters — January highs near 69°F vs 32°F
Cons
Pricier housing — median home is $777,100
Higher rents — median is $1,977/mo
Cost of living runs 24% higher than South Bend
Living costs are well above the U.S. average (index 115.5)
